He he!!  It was caused by --- millions of windows systems all  
patching and rebooting at the same time:

> Obviously not ready for prime-time stuff. My household experienced  
> a brown-out and then a black-out last night, and upon recovery,  
> Skype wouldn't login. I thought that it might have been related,  
> until I read this:
>
> "UPDATED 14:02 GMT: Some of you may be having problems logging into  
> Skype. Our engineering team has determined that it’s a software  
> issue. We expect this to be resolved within 12 to 24 hours.  
> Meanwhile, you can simply leave your Skype client running and as  
> soon as the issue is resolved, you will be logged in. We apologize  
> for the inconvenience.
> Additionally, downloads of Skype have been temporarily disabled. We  
> will make downloads available again as quickly as possible."
>
> Notably, the stock price of eBay went down on this announcement  
> (i.e., it's serious - eBay owns Skype).
